I finally had time to add support to k8temp  for the new family 10h and family
11h of CPUs.

The patch adds support for new fam10h and fam11h CPUs (aka Phenom and new 45nm
CPUs). The patch was tested on K8 fam 0fh revE and revF CPU. I dont know if it
works at all on new CPUs. Please test. You should see the max temp (always 70C
and one temperature per CPU). Of course test is on your own risk ;)

Andreas, please is TcontrolMax also 70C for fam 11h CPUs?

The patch needs review too. I tried not to change many things in the driver,
especially the sensorsp logic, but mine test sempron has -49 at core0 place0,
which needs to be fixed by another logic which will tell driver what CPU
temperatures are usable. But maybe this is for another "cleanup" patch. I think
we really need to get this kind of change to kernel first.
